About This Book
Bigfoot stomps through the forest, dodging trees and leaping over rocks! Suddenly, he stops—something's changing. What secret is nature about to reveal?

Quick Assessment
This engaging early reader uses a comic book style to introduce children ages 5-8 to the concept of biological adaptation through the adventures of Bigfoot. The simple text and illustrations help young readers grasp scientific ideas in a fun and accessible way. Suitable for early readers, it combines fiction with basic science without any intense content.
